Archeological findings show that the olive tree existed in 6000 BC; fossils of a sub variety of the olive tree have been found in the Mardin-Kahramanmaraş-Hatay triangle, which is the homeland of olives. Savrani, which is one of the four olive varieties produced by NAR in Hatay, is maybe one of the oldest known olives of the world. With the Savrani olive oil NAR brings the traces of the olive farming in Antakya, which is one of the oldest settlements of the world, to our day.
